“Charlie Hebdo chief says the magazine has ‘nothing to regret’ in publishing cartoons of prophet Mohammed, adding: ‘If we don’t fight for our freedom we promote a deadly ideology,'” by Jack Newman, Daily Mail, September 9, 2020 (thanks to The Religion of Peace):

The current director of Charlie Hebdo says the magazine has ‘nothing to regret’ for publishing cartoons of the prophet Mohammed.

Laurent Sourisseau, known as ‘Riss’ and who was himself badly wounded in the shoulder in the attack, said on Wednesday he stands by the controversial editorial decision which angered Muslims all over the world.

He was speaking at the trial of 14 suspected accomplices to the 2015 attacks at the satirical magazine’s offices and a Jewish supermarket that left a total of 17 dead.

Sourisseau said: ‘I don’t want to be dependent on the insane arbitrariness of fanatics.’

He added ‘there is nothing to regret’ in having published the caricatures of Mohammed in 2006.

‘What I regret is to see how little people fight to defend freedom. If we don’t fight for our freedom, we live like a slave and we promote a deadly ideology.’

Ten people were killed inside the offices of Charlie Hebdo including Jean Cabut, known as Cabu, 76, Georges Wolinski, 80, and Stephane ‘Charb’ Charbonnier, 47, who were among France’s most celebrated cartoonists.

Sourisseau, 53, who succeeded Charb as head of the publication, insisted that freedom is ‘not something that drops from the sky’.

‘We grew up without imagining that one day our freedoms would be put into question.’

Recalling the horror of the attack by the brothers Cherif and Said Kouachi, he said: ‘The immediate sensation after the attack is that you have been cut in half and you were being deprived of a part of yourself.’

Sourisseau now lives under round the clock protection. ‘It is like I am under house arrest.’

Defiant as ever, Charlie Hebdo last week republished the cartoons of the prophet Mohammed, drawing new condemnation from states including Iran, Pakistan and Turkey.

‘If we had given up the right to publish these cartoons, that would mean that we were wrong to do so’ in the first place, he said.

He followed a survivor of the 2015 attack who revealed at court on Wednesday how the gunmen said ‘Allahu akbar’ (God is greatest), then shot him with their Kalashnikov rifles.

He said that after being shot he lost consciousness, and the gunmen moved on to other targets.

Speaking to a French court on Wednesday, Fieschi, 36, was forced to relive his traumatic experiences during the trial of 14 suspects accused of aiding the gunmen.

The survivor limped to the witness box using a crutch and declined to offer a seat, testifying standing.

The magazine’s webmaster said: ‘It was all very quick for me.

‘I remember the door opening violently, and gunshots. I remember a man who said: ‘Allahu akbar,’ and then, ‘We don’t kill women’….
